Abstract
The quantum dynamics of the state of a field is studied for the process of intracavity third harmonic generation in the region of unstable behavior of the system in the case in which the interacting modes are developed from initial coherent states. It is shown that the Wigner functions of the states of the modes and mean values of the quadrature amplitudes of the fields can have oscillations disappearing with the transition of the system to a stable region.
